Average working velocities from the 23 African include 3050fps to 3100fps with 225 grain bullets, 3000fps to 3050fps with 235 grain bullets, 2900fps with 250 grain bullets, 2850fps using 260 grain bullets, 2800fps for the 270 grainers, 2700fps with 300 grain bullets and 2450fps with 350 gain longsters. The goal of the engineers was not to exceed .375 H&H performance but simply to equal it in a cartridge that would fit in a standard-length (.30-06-length) action and fit existing belted magnum bolt faces. In 24-inch test barrels, the .375 Ruger sent 270-grain bullets at 2,840 fps and 300s at 2,660, trumping the .375 H&H by more than 100 fps. He did. It is also worth noting that Hornadys Superformance loads for the .375 H&H almost duplicate the .375 Ruger loadings, though without the same level of efficiency. Handloading for the .375 Ruger is a straightforward affair; look to a large rifle magnum primer and powders like Reloder 15, 16 and 17, H380, VARGET and IMR4064, IMR4166, IMR4350 and IMR4451, depending on the bullet your loading. As with most medium bores the .375 Ruger produces best results across all bullet weights with powders in the IMR / H 4350 range, though the faster Varget burn rate can work very well with light weight bullets. As Ruger intended the cartridge to be chambered in short-length bolt-action rifles,[2] the case length was shortened to 2.10in (53mm), which is similar to the .308 Winchester case. Although it has since spawned the .416 Ruger and the shortened Ruger Compact Magnums (RCMs), it started as an original case design that used the .532-inch rim but without a belt, the case is fatter with little body taper and a 60-degree shoulder. In rifles which yield full velocities of 2850fps, the 260 grain Partition breaks 2200fps at around 235 yards and 1800fps at around 400 yards.
